Mass and Pressure Calibration
Whether you're loading gas cylinders or evaluating pharmaceutical powders, accuracy in mass and stress dimensions is non-negotiable. Certified laboratories use deadweight testers for stress and mass comparators for weight, guaranteeing your determines and ranges match national requirements.

Micrometers, Meters, and Other Dimensional Checks
When you're machining parts to micro-tight resistances, also a few microns can matter. Micrometers, calipers, and direct meters should be consistently checked in an assessment lab to guarantee they fulfill specified resistances. Skilled professionals utilize scale blocks and interferometers to confirm straight dimensions with extreme accuracy.

Recognizing ISO 17025 vs. Other Standards
ISO 17025 covers basic demands for the capability of testing and calibration labs. It makes sure traceability, correct unpredictability estimations, and extensive quality assurance treatments. On the other hand, standards like ISO 9001 focus on broader top quality administration systems but might not dive into certain technical methodologies.
